Salted Sage Honey Butter Brioche Rolls

Description

Soft and fluffy brioche rolls brushed with sweet honey butter and finished with aromatic sage, perfect for a comforting homemade treat.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 ½ cups bread flour
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• 2 ¼ teaspoons instant yeast
  • ¾ cup warm milk
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 3 large eggs
  • ¼ cup honey
  • 1 tablespoon fresh sage leaves, finely chopped
  • 1 te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F and prepare a baking dish.
  2. In a large bowl, combine bread flour, sugar, yeast, warm milk, eggs, butter, and salt until a soft dough forms.
  3. Lightly grease the baking dish to prevent sticking.
  4. Shape the dough into small balls and arrange evenly in the dish.
  5.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es until golden brown and cooked through.
  6. Mix honey with melted butter, brush over warm rolls, and sprinkle with chopped sage.
  7. Let cool slightly, then serve warm.

Notes

  • Use room temperature ingredients for best results.
  • Do not overbake to keep the rolls soft.
  • Fresh sage provides the best flavor and aroma.
